Thursday, August 27th, 2009 5:00 a.m. to 8:00 p.m. (hopefully)
Where:
The route begins in Monterey, CA and winds through Pacific Grove, Pebble Beach, and Carmel. It's a 50-mile back-and forth route that I'll be completing twice.
My goal is to raise $7,500 with the Run for the Wildlands to support the California Invasive Plant Council's (Cal-IPC) programs to protect native habitats from non-native invasive plant species.
